Training is the cornerstone of safety at UPS, and management training is the logical precursor to an informed and safe workforce. Safety professionals at UPS teach a comprehensive range of workshops, certifying frontline managers and supervisors who in turn, teach hourly employees in the specifics of each course. This train-the-trainer approach ensures consistency and enables safety personnel in each district to reinforce safe work and safe driving habits.
UPS employees receive nearly 1.3 million hours of safety training annually, including Safe Work Methods. UPS Safe Work Methods have been developed to help address the major sources of known risk to our employees. The six methods are:
- Job set-up
- Lifting and lowering
- Slips and falls
- Pushing and pulling
- Powered equipment
- Plan for the unexpected
